Fishing Rod

Fishing Rods are recurring Items in The Legend of Zelda series.[1][2][name references needed]

Location and Uses

Link's Awakening

In Link's Awakening, Link can use a Fishing Rod in the Fishing minigame located north of Madam MeowMeow's house in Mabe Village.

Ocarina of Time

In Ocarina of Time, Link can rent a Fishing Rod as a child and adult in the Fishing Pond located in Lake Hylia. For 20 Rupees, he can use it for as long as he wants.[3] However, it can only be used inside the pond, as Link must return it before leaving.[4]

The default Lure of the Fishing Rod can only float. However, Link can find the Sinking Lure around the pond, making the lure sink to the bottom of it. Although, the use of a Sinking Lure is against the rules.[5][6] Besides fishing, adult Link can use the Rod to steal the Fisherman's hat.

Twilight Princess

In Twilight Princess, two types of Fishing Rod appears: the Bobber Fishing Rod and the Lure Fishing Rod. The Bobber Fishing Rod is obtained from Uli after saving her cradle from a Monkey.[7] Link can use it to fish almost anywhere a body of water is located. Any fish caught with the Bobber Fishing Rod are kept in the Fish Journal. Link can also add Bait, such as worms and bee larvae, to attract fishes more easily. The Rod is first needed to catch a fish for Sera's cat so Link can get the Slingshot. Afterwards, Link must use the Rod again to catch a Reekfish in Zora's Domain in order to follow Yeto's trail. However, to catch a Reekfish, Link must first obtain the Coral Earring from Ralis.[8] The earring serves as an upgrade to the Rod, as it also increases the fish bitting rate. Link can also use the Bobber Fishing Rod to catch an empty Bottle and the Sinking Lure in Hena's Fishing Hole.

The Lure Fishing Rod can be rented in Hena's Fishing Hole for 20 or 100 Rupees. The Lure Fishing Rod is controlled differently from the Bobber Fishing Rod and can only be used while riding a canoe inside the pond. It also allows Link to use a wider variety of lures. Besides fishing, Link can also use the Rod to catch a Piece of Heart in the middle of the Fishing Hole.

Phantom Hourglass

In Phantom Hourglass, the Fishing Rod can be obtained from the Old Wayfarer on Bannan Island by introducing Joanne to him.[9] Link can only use the Rod while sailing the World of the Ocean King on board the SS Linebeck. When the ship is above a fish shadow, Link can cast the Rod and try to catch the fish by tapping the touch screen.[10]

Majora's Mask 3D

In Majora's Mask 3D, Link can rent a Fishing Rod in either of the Fishing Ponds located next to the Swamp Shooting Gallery or in the Great Bay. Link can rent the rod for 50 Rupees or for free if he has a Fishing Hole Pass. This time, he can freely use the Sinking Lure whenever he wants.

Non-Canon Appearances

Oracle of Ages (Himekawa)

In the Oracle of Ages manga by Akira Himekawa, a Fishing Rod is used by Sir Raven. Link finds the knight fishing near a river in Labrynna.[11] Raven continues fishing until a fish bites on the line.[12] He pulls it out of the water and unhooks it from the Rod. After a struggle between Link and the knight, Raven asks the hero to come with him and picks up the Fishing Rod before leaving.[13]

Trivia

  • In Twilight Princess, it is possible to distract Ganondorf using the Fishing Rod during the final battle. Ganondorf will watch the hook of the rod, leaving him open to attacks.
